    Battery

    A frequent issue is the battery inside the car key fob. It's a good idea keep a spare battery at home or in your car just in the case. The process of changing a fob is quite simple however, it differs from car manufacturer to car manufacturer. Check out the owner's manual for more information.

    Typically, you'll need either a CR2025, or CR2032, 3-Volt battery. These can be found at most electronics stores or even your local auto parts store. You will also need an opening screwdriver to access the fob, and remove the old battery. It is recommended to work on a flat, clean surface with ample light to avoid loosing any small pieces.

    As the fob battery wears out and the signal to the car will weaken. The range of the fob will be reduced and you may have to be nearer to the vehicle in order to unlock or start the car. The battery will eventually fail, and you'll have to replace it.

    The key fob is divided into two sections that is the front key section and the transmitter portion that includes the battery. To access the transmitter section, open the key fob and then use a screwdriver for the separation of the two sections. Lift the cover to the area of the arrow using the screwdriver and remove the batteries from the previous one. Install the new battery and ensure that the + symbol is facing downwards. Replace the cover by pressing the two sections together.

    To change the battery on a skoda key fob programming Octavia Replacement Key Cost (Https://Reimer-Whalen.Mdwrite.Net/) key fob you must first take off the housing of the key fob in order to gain access to the circuit board. This is done by using a small "key" embedded in the seam of the unit to pull the housing open. Care must be taken to avoid damaging the key fob housing. The key fob is powered by the type of disc battery CR2032. Depending on usage the battery should last for two to four years.

    The old battery is taken out and a new one is installed. Be sure to insert the new battery in the correct way. On the inside of the cover of the key fob, a small guide shows the correct orientation. Key blades can also be replaced during this time. You can purchase an additional key blade at a parts store or have a locksmith cut it for you.
